Mink 

Traits: Mammal with large canine teeth; a long, slender body; short legs; long, round tail; dense brown fur; feet not webbed

Habitat: Streams, lakes, marshes, inlets, estuaries

Foods: Muskrats, voles, lemmings; eggs and young of ducks, geese, and shorebirds; fish, frogs, mussels, aquatic insects

Eaten by: Hawks, owls, lynx, foxes, coyotes, wolves

Do You Know? Like all other weasels, mink have an anal scent gland that produces a strong odor.
